MG Astor Officially REVEALED, Meet India’s first AI Powered Car

This comes from straight from the Chinese owned English carmaker MG who has for some godforsaken reason silently revealed the soon to launch MG Astor.

For those who still think that it is a new car from MG. The MG Astor is nothing but the rebadged version of the MG ZS EV which has obviously been renamed and slight updated.

Anything new on the mechanical front?

  • It is speculated to come mated to a 1.5-litre NA petrol and a 1.3-litre turbo-petrol engine.
  • Both the engines produce 120hp with a peak torque of 150Nm of peak torque and 163hp with 230Nm of peak torque.
  • Transmission options include a standard 6-speed manual alongside an optional automatic gearbox.

What’s new on the feature end?

  • So this is where things get pretty serious as this will be the first time when we will get to see a fully AI-Powered car in the country.
  • The soon to launch will get its own AI personal Assistant and is the first car that gets the Concept of Car-as-a-Platform (CAAP) software.

  •   The platform integrates features such as Blockchain, Machine Learning and Artificial Intelligence allowing buyers to choose from a personalised et of services.
  • These services include maps navigations from MapMyIndia and phone connectivity services powered by Jio.
  • The ZS platform based Astor will also be the first car to feature Level 2 ADAS technology.

  • The features on the Level 2 ADAS include Adaptive Cruise Control, Forward Collision Warning, Automatic Emergency Braking, Lane Keep Assist, Lane Departure Warning, Lane Departure Prevention, Intelligent Headlamp Control (IHC), Rear Drive Assist and Speed Assist System and so on.

India launch and Rivals?

  • We can expect to see the MG Astor anytime by the end of this year or by early 2022.
  • With its launch, the MG Astor will rival the likes of the Renault Duster, Kia Seltos, Hyundai Creta and the Mahindra XUV500.
